We have to give credit to fast food joints like White Castle and Arby’s that have caught onto Slider Mania. Some have only dabbled with them a bit. McDonalds in particular tested out sliders - McTasters - back in 2016. Unfortunately, they were only offered for a limited time at select Canadian locations and were never added as a permanent menu item.
